Chalk up another record year for the Georgia Ports Authority. The total volume of goods handled by the ports increased nearly 8 percent from last year and there was a double-digit increase in the number of container units handled at the Port of Savannah. An executive says to expect more businesses to utilize our seaports and notes steps that have been, or will be, taken to make that a reality. Elsewhere, we touch on two other topics — how to answer the demand for a skilled manufacturing workforce and proposed changes in patent protection laws.
